MBRS1100T3, MBRS190T3
Preferred Devices
Schottky Power Rectifier
Surface Mount Power Package
Features
Pb−Free Packages are Available
Small Compact Surface Mountable Package with J-Bend Leads
Rectangular Package for Automated Handling
Highly Stable Oxide Passivated Junction
High Blocking Voltage − 100 Volts
175°C Operating Junction Temperature
Guardring for Stress Protection
Mechanical Characteristics
Case: Epoxy, Molded
Weight: 95 mg (approximately)
Finish: All External Surfaces Corrosion Resistant and Terminal
Leads are Readily Solderable
Lead and Mounting Surface Temperature for Soldering Purposes:
260°C Max. for 10 Seconds
Shipped in 12 mm Tape and Reel, 2500 units per reel
Cathode Polarity Band
